Registration u/s 12AA and u/s 80G denied - Whether objects of ...


Registration Denied: Trust's Charitable Objectives and Activities Under Scrutiny u/ss 12AA and 80G.

June 27, 2020

Case Laws     Income Tax     AT

Registration u/s 12AA and u/s 80G denied - Whether objects of the society/trust should be charitable in nature and the activities of the society/trust should be genuine? - The genuineness of the activities would mean that the activities are not bogus or artificial or camouflaged by some means and whether the activities are in accordance with the object of the institution.
